I have just installed my brand new GA-Z68XP-UD3, I have updated the firmware to F7 (the latest on the Gigabyte website for my MB) and all the latest drivers are installed
I have 2 x Hitachi 500GB drives I am attempting to RAID via the Marvell controller
I have a RUNCORE 60GB SSD in the mSATA slot on the MB and I currently have the Intel RAID configured so the SSD is caching a Samsung 1GB non RAIDed drive however; this requires me to have the Intel RAID configured to be in RAID mode (I intend to RAID all the drives although I am part way through at the moment)
When I have the Marvell controller in AHCI mode all is well however; the moment I follow the instruction in the manual to enable RAID on the Marvell controller I get the following boot up warning and am unable to access Ctl-I menu to configure the Marvell RAID controller
I believe this is a fundemental error in the BIOS set up partly because there is nothing in the manual stating I cannot enable RAID on both and also because in my research I have noticed similar problem with other Gigabyte MB's that provide both Intel & Marvell RAID controllers. It appears BIOS version F9 on some boards resolves this problem
When is the BIOS update that resolves this problem being made available for the GA-Z68XP-UD3 MB?
